American Legion 594 Turner-Rag

Fiscal year ending 2020. Filed on November 12, 2021.

3121 Napier Ave
Macon, Georgia 31204

American Legion 594 Turner-Rag (EIN: 23-7247832)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2019. In its fiscal year 2020 IRS Form 990 filing, American Legion 594 Turner-Rag, a 501(c)(19) veterans' organization, reported compensation for 5 out of 15 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0.
